Hello all,

A summary of what is on the way:

Mintcoin Fund, the world's first legally-registered NGO for a crypto. The bylaws are been sent for registration with the French administration. The goal will be to promote Mintcoin and sustainable developement through financing of actions. As the dev said: "MintCoin Fund will bring us a lot more media coverage than Coinkite could ever do" (source)

The website will be made public soon, hopefully for Earth Day.

What is needed for the moment:
- contacting sustainable developement causes that you have an active part in (because these are the easier one to reach), ideally, they could get matching contribution for the government and would not need much money, since Mintcoin still has a low value
- donating to the Fund (the fund had been finance with the pre-mine, so these donations would not go to the funding, they would be used later projects). The donation address is: MsKZ6xRSPJAVVJ7m1oZfNqVcpJ9MyvRzha[/font]. Presently it is at zero since it was just created (please someone send a link to the a working explorer for direct access)

There is already an ongoing project, Sonoma County Reforestation Plan. THe Project leader is tokyopotato, who is working there.
